In August, a WordCamp for publishers will be held in Denver. It is the first of its kind. The event will feature those who use WordPress to help with digital publishing. What is WordCamp for Publishers? Learn more below

WordCamp for Publishers is a community-organized event bringing together folks who use WordPress to manage publications, big or small. This event will empower participants by coaching them on best practices, and encourage collaboration in building open source tools for publishers.

Largo, Insitute for Nonprofit News

I came across this project a few months ago. Largo is WordPress development framework for publishers. The team at the Institute for Nonprofit News took the time to build into the framework some of the things needed to run an online publication. The framework is open source, keeping the cost down for smaller publishing companies, many of who are nonprofits.

One of the supporters of Largo is Ben Keith and he is an organizer of the WordCamp for Publishers. It really is nice to see these two worlds coming together to support each other.

Advertising Plugins

If you are running an online publication, at some point you begin to wonder about advertising revenue. Plugins can make it much easier to insert self-hosted ads on your website.

Advance Ads

I have been using WP Advance Ads for a while now and have been pleased. The plugin has not given me any issues working with other WordPress products. Thomas is constantly improving and he provides stellar support. The base plugin is free. While the add-ons cost, the prices are reasonable and there are packages.Further, I have been very pleased with any support questions I have submitted. The developer responds quite promptly.

OIOPublisher

One of the more popular advertising plugins is OIOPublisher. OIOPublisher is fairly comprehensive and allows advertisers to sign up on your website with the use of a zone layout system. The price point for this plugin is reasonable as well. According to an article, WP Beginner uses OIOPublisher to manage its ads.

Local Media Genesis Child Theme

If you are a Genesis developer you may want to check out VSELLIS Media’s Local Media Child theme. The theme was designed specifically for hyperlocal news publishers. Scott Ellis, the owner, and developer, uses the theme to run his own hyper-local website, Lifestyle Frisco.

StudioPress, the parent company of the Genesis Framework, has a couple of themes in its portfolio that can be used. One is for magazines and one is for new, and both look really nice.

Anvil is an All-in-one Dashboard for digital publishers from ZEEN101. According to the website,

This is the only platform that enables publishers to manage their publications, content, social media distribution, mobile apps, advertisers, and subscribers all in one WordPress dashboard.

Do you need another page builder? Two different page builders serve as sponsors at the WordCamp for Publishers, Mesh Plugin, and BoldGrid.

Mesh is a product created by Linchpin and is a “. . .  a simple, responsive solution for adding multiple sections of content within WordPress pages, posts and custom post types.” Mesh can really be a powerful solution for the more complex layouts that some digital publishers utilize.

BoldGrid is a theme framework with multiple layouts. The themes are easily customizable and fantastic for WordPress beginners. Thes products allow publishers to be publishers rather than worrying about being a developer.
